Reverse
A bust of Hidalgo surrounded by captions indicating the value of the coin, the year of issue, circled by the same beading on the front.
Script: Latin
Lettering: DIEZ PESOS M* 1910
Translation: Ten Pesos
Edge
Plain

Interesting fact
The Pattern 10 Pesos (Pattern; Hidalgo; Copper) 1910 from Mexico made of Copper is a rare and unique coin that was never circulated. It was created as a pattern coin, which means it was produced as a prototype or sample for a potential coin design, but it was ultimately not adopted for circulation. As a result, only a limited number of these coins were minted, making them highly sought after by collectors.
